A construction project is an organization of specialists, headed by the project manager. Included in the organization are various field engineers, scheduling and cost control analysts, estimators, quality control and material control experts, labor and craft supervisors, skilled craftsmen, and many others, all with a broad range of experience within their individual specialties and skillfully organized to work within the framework of a tightly scheduled project contract. It is a business of temporary employment and temporary assignments. Skilled craftsmen, hired by the hour and working under union agreement, complete their job specialty as needed during the construction phase of the project and are then laid off, to be rehired again by another company for another project. Even the smaller semipermanent staff of engineers and construction management personnel is on temporary assignment until the completion of the project, whereupon they must be reassigned to a new project.
